From: A living library concept to capture the dynamics and reactivity of mixed-metal clusters for catalysis

Fig. 1

Mixed-metal cluster libraries are generated by combining highly reactive organometallic precursors at a defined set of conditions. Library perturbation is initiated by changing the conditions, for example, by the addition of substrates, and the evolution over time is monitored via mass spectrometry (Cu, orange; Zn, blue; carbon, grey; oxygen, red).
